> Below is what I use. I allow users to set their own
> settings stored in a
> mysql db. Note: the 'defang_mime' and 'report_header' went
> away with SA
> 2.50-ish. (I just haven't pulled them from my config yet.)
>
> -----
>
> use_dcc 0
> spam_level_stars 0
> skip_rbl_checks 0
> dcc_add_header 1
> allow_user_rules 0
> all_spam_to postmaster at amigo.net abuse at amigo.net
>
> # User configurable via web page.
> rewrite_subject 0
> report_header 1
> defang_mime 0
> use_terse_report 0
>
> user_scores_dsn DBI:mysql:Accounts:10.1.1.1
> user_scores_sql_username <user>
> user_scores_sql_password <pass>
> user_scores_sql_table SA_userprefs
